Level 3 First Aid at Work Requalification (2 Days)
- Course Duration:2 Days
- Course Validity:3 Years
The 2 Day First Aid at Work (FAW) Requalification course is aimed at first aiders whose 3 Day FAW certificate is nearing expiry. It refreshes key skills to keep you compliant with the Health & Safety (First Aid) Regulations 1981.
Upon successful completion, you will renew your Level 3 FAW qualification, allowing you to serve as a trained first aider in both low and high risk workplaces.

Who should attend the First Aid at Work Requalification course?
First Aid at Work Requalification course is ideal for first aiders whose 3 Day FAW certificate is approaching expiry and need to renew their qualification. It is suitable for employees working in medium to high risk workplaces, such as construction, manufacturing, engineering, and large organisations, as well as staff in low risk environments who originally completed the full 3 Day FAW course and need to maintain compliance. The course is perfect for anyone responsible for ensuring their workplace has trained first aiders to meet Health & Safety (First Aid) Regulations 1981.
Course Duration:
6 hours (usually 9:00 AM – 4:00 PM) over 2 days. Flexible timings are available for group bookings at your venue.
Please note that if you originally completed the 1 Day Emergency First Aid at Work (EFAW) course, you only need to renew that qualification rather than this 2 Day requalification.
What is covered?
This 2 Day First Aid at Work Refresher course refreshes skills for those who have already completed the full 3 Day First Aid at Work (FAW) course.
- Managing unresponsive casualties
- Performing CPR & safe AED use
- Recovery position and monitoring
- Heart attack, stroke, epilepsy, asthma, diabetes
- Anaphylaxis and shock
- Head, spinal, and chest injuries
- Fractures, sprains, dislocations Wounds, bleeding, and burns
- Eye injuries and poisoning

To successfully complete this first aid training course, learners will be assessed through practical real-life scenarios, knowledge checks, and a final exam featuring multiple choice and open questions.
Upon passing, you will gain the certification, skills, and confidence needed to act as a qualified workplace first aider.
All our workplace First Aid certificates we issue are nationally recognised, acknowledged, and certified by governing bodies like FAIB and Qualsafe Awards, which ensures that you have met the Health & Safety (First Aid) 1981 Regulations for your workplace.
